I've read on these forums there have been some markers released that have bounce issues. Can anyone with a bounce issue chime in? I want to know if the bounce can be eliminated by adjusting the trigger and/or adjusting the debounce higher than the stock setting of 5.
aceofspades05
02-03-2006, 11:34 PM
my bounce is completely gone at rates up to 16-17bps on my quest, never touched the trigger adjustments just used the board, new NoX chip just came out for quest that is able to be more fine tuned
ninjanick
02-05-2006, 01:12 AM
The stock Quest programming has debounce allowable from 1 to 50. Does th Nox chip go to 100 or some number greater than 50? The stock setting of 5 seems to be ok with some slight bounce, but anything after 8 or 10 I get 0 bounce. Did you have to adjust the AMB as well? Are we talking slow pull bounce issues or fast pull issues?
aceofspades05
02-05-2006, 01:16 AM
well there are other variables that can be changed when setting up a gun other than debounce, my quest when i first got it back at cup had mad slow pull bounce and so of course even more at fast pull, it was all electronic though, but its a magnetic trigger and all magnetic triggers can bounce but ive NEVER adjusted my quests trigger (its amazing as is) and it doesnt bounce, played at Delmarva and a ref at the chrono checks your gun for slow pull bounce before every single game, never got a single bounce and it doesnt bounce at high rofs, but my debounce is at 48 lol
ninjanick
02-05-2006, 05:40 PM
Wow that is pretty high! I have my trigger set to middle activation about 2-3mm with the magnet screwed as far out as possible to give as light a feel as possible. My settings are AMB 2 and debounce 7 with 0 bounce, but then again I might not be gifted at the slow bounce thing. Plus, my Quest was one of the original builds as it still has the Angel grips. Maybe they changed the mechanics slightly?
aceofspades05
02-05-2006, 07:02 PM
not sure, got one of the first 60, im sure i could turn debounce down but its not needed because its fine as is
